Perhaps the most ignored part of training is the fear factor. We begin our martial arts training with a punch, a kick, a block, but only decades later do I realize how useless this all is. Our training is all wrong. We are learning techniques that most of us will never be able to use. I refer to those as great tools locked away in our tool box. When the need arises for these tools we find that we simply cannot find the key to unlock our tool box. So of what value are our tools? of no value whatsoever. That is the sad but honest truth. 

A great source of truth for me is the eternal Holy Bible, which I take as the word of God. For me it is not only a historical text of the word of the Almighty Eternal but as God speaking to me personally as I need guidance. Yes, I see it as having this power.

So yesterday I was sitting in my favorite synagogue in the Valley here in North Hollywood, California. The Yemenite synagogue, Maor Haim, which means the Source of Life. And behold I heard God's word.

The Children of Israel were leaving Egypt, they have been slaves for many years. God was concerned about their slave mentality, as such he delayed them, he rerouted them, "Lest they have a change of heart when they see war and decide to return to Egypt." (Exodus, Chapter 13, verse 17). God had reason for concern. So he re-routed them through the desert. God prepared them for a possible encounter with a violent determined enemy. First we had the Ten Plagues; the Children of Israel saw first-hand the power of God Almighty. He saw the damage God inflicted upon Egypt. Then they experienced the miracle of the Exodus.  and it is written the they left Egypt armed with weapons. Thus we can presume that they were trained in the use of those weapons just as Father Abraham trained his household in the art of the weapons. We are a Nation of Warriors!  

So they were prepared and armed and God Himself was leading them on this journey, for He led them during the day with a cloud and at night with a pillar of fire. But now the real test comes, the test of fear. Every black belt knows this fear, we face it in our black belt test. You are prepared, you are armed, you know what to expect, you have your weapons, your martial arts tools, and then you must face the fear factor, the well-rested opponents who are out to beat you to a pulp. I recall my tests, Itay Gil said to me, I am not testing your skills, I am testing your will to live, to survive. And now the Children of Israel are going to face the might of Pharaoh and Egypt!

But what happens? Fear takes hold of them. They are not quite ready, and they begin to cry to Moshe. Now imagine the scene; you have no real life combat experience, and suddenly you see facing you, approaching rapidly, the might of the nation of Egypt, all the chariots of Egypt with the finest commanders chosen to lead the battle. (Chapter 14)  

But the Egyptians pursued after them, all the horses and chariots of Pharaoh, and his horsemen, and his army, and overtook them encamping by the sea, beside Pi hahiroth, before Baalzephon.

10 And when Pharaoh drew nigh, the children of Israel lifted up their eyes, and, behold, the Egyptians marched after them; and they were sore afraid: and the children of Israel cried out unto the Lord.

11 And they said unto Moses, Because there were no graves in Egypt, hast thou taken us away to die in the wilderness? wherefore hast thou dealt thus with us, to carry us forth out of Egypt?

12 Is not this the word that we did tell thee in Egypt, saying, Let us alone, that we may serve the Egyptians? For it had been better for us to serve the Egyptians, than that we should die in the wilderness.

Can you imagine the sight? Who would not be afraid? and now we hear the voices of doubt. We hear that many do not wish to fight. We also are told that in fact there was a large faction of the Hebrews who were opposed to this idea of Liberation from the very start, as it is written, Behold, is this not what we told you back in Egypt, as we said, Let us be, leave us alone and let us serve as slaves to the Egyptians, that is better than taking us out on his folly of a journey to die in the desert, in the wilderness. 

There will always be those who do not believe in the dream, who will tell you; stay an employee, serve the master, give up the idea of starting your own business. Give up your idea of becoming a black belt. There will always be those who doubt. Moshe, Moses, is speaking of national liberation but we now realize that many opposed his leadership, they opposed his mission, they doubted him. And at the first sign of failure those doubts came back, and they were ready to turn back on the Big Dream.

Martial arts is a life lesson, martial arts, Krav Maga, are a means to an end; that end is a better life. We believe in the dream, we will not turn back on our dream. There will always be doubters, and some of those doubts will come from within you yourself.
